The muscles never cease twitching; pushing,
they can't stand; none of them is still ever;
some laugh. Anticipating the next routine,
they go in circles in public spaces
to reproduce the signs they’ve tried learning.
The dead could not be worse off than these fools,
bumping, in misery, into each other;
hats dragged hard over half-shut eyes; headphones
fouling their ears; hands yawn into pockets;
feet drop in fat boots under some decorative words.
